bcache: fix ioctl in flash device



commit dd0c91793b7c2658ea32c6b3a2247a8ceca45dc0 upstream.

When doing ioctl in flash device, it will call ioctl_dev() in super.c,
then we should not to get cached device since flash only device has
no backend device. This patch just move the jugement dc->io_disable
to cached_dev_ioctl() to make ioctl in flash device correctly.

Fixes: 0f0709e6 ("bcache: stop bcache device when backing device is offline")
